Who needs general limitations and exclusions?
01
Insurance policyholders: General limitations and exclusions are important for policyholders to understand the scope of coverage and any potential restrictions or conditions.
02
Insurance agents and brokers: They need to be familiar with general limitations and exclusions in order to effectively advise and educate their clients.
03
Underwriters and claims adjusters: These professionals need to consider general limitations and exclusions when assessing risks and processing claims.
04
Legal professionals: Lawyers and legal advisors may need to review general limitations and exclusions to provide legal advice or settle disputes related to insurance coverage.
05
Regulatory authorities: They need to ensure that insurance providers comply with the relevant laws and regulations, including the fair and transparent application of general limitations and exclusions.

What is the purpose of general limitations and exclusions?
The purpose of general limitations and exclusions is to clarify the boundaries of coverage, protect against excessive liability, and ensure that stakeholders understand the limitations of what is provided under a policy.
